Alicia Diana Santos Colmenero (born June 9, 1950), better known as Diana Santos, is a Mexican voice actress who has dubbed Minnie Mouse's voice in Latin Spanish, the part of Takeshi in the Spanish dubbed version of the 1967–1968 Japanese television program Comet-San.[1] She has also been credited as Ad Santos (with "Ad" being "A.D.", which stands for her initials "Alicia Diana"). She is the daughter of Edmundo Santos and Alicia Colmenero.[2]

Honours and awards

On November 28, 2020, during the 2nd Lavat Awards ceremony held in Mexico City, Diana Santos received an honorary award in recognition for her lifetime work as a dubbing actress spanning 64 years. The ceremony was broadcast live on the Lavat Awards official website due to the COVID-19 pandemic, as opposed to the previous year.[4]
